CHRUDIM. The official estimate of the cultivated area by the Czech Statistical Office came as a surprise to the Czech poppy seed industry. However, the fields urgently need rain to stem the crop losses.

Crop decline not confirmed

The Czech Statistical Office recently published the cultivation forecast for the 2023 poppy seed crop. Market players had repeatedly stressed that a decline in cultivation area compared to last year from 26,000 ha to 16,000-18,000 ha was to be expected and have shown themselves to be correspondingly surprised. The official estimate provides for other figures, because according to this, similar to 2022, around 26,000 ha will have been cultivated with poppy seeds again this year.
